Describe the bug
Deleting your account works as expected, but it also redirects users to /signin immediately after signing them out. This means the "Your account has successfully been deleted" message only appears for a split second before it disappears. I knew to look for it, but most users would not. Meaning they might misunderstand and think their account has not been deleted successfully.

To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Go to the bottom of /settings
  2. Click the "delete my account" button and confirm.
  3. You will be redirected twice – once to the unauthenticated landing page, and then immediately afterward to /signin
